Samsung Galaxy Book S with Intel ‘hybrid chip’ announced – Micky News
Samsung Galaxy Book S is finally available in retail stores. This is the first laptop to ship out with the new Intel “Lakefield” processors.
This year’s Samsung Galaxy Book S is taking advantage of Intel’s “Hybrid technology.” This Galaxy Book version is the first Intel-powered device in the current line-up.
Qualcomm Snapdragon powers the previous Samsung Galaxy Book devices. Samsung’s decision to go with Intel makes these devices more powerful.
